Chapter 943 Entering the Palace

Being summoned by the palace is a big deal. Although His Majesty is not here, the Queen who is in power now is also the monarch to them.

After the news came out, the capital, which was already bustling with excitement because of the exam, became even more lively, and those who were on the list were nervous and excited. Not to mention the students from poor families, even those from powerful families were preparing with great confidence.

Three days later, on the day of the summons, everyone gathered in front of the palace gate early.

As more than fifty students stood there waiting to be summoned by the palace, they were clearly divided into several camps. Rongsheng Academy alone had twenty-one students, led by Li Chi and Huang Hong. More than ten children of powerful families were headed by Feng Yian from the Feng family's branch. The remaining scattered children from poor families gathered around Jin Shengyu, a student from Jiangnan.

About half of the people on the list were from Rongsheng Academy. They wore the uniform white-based black bamboo academy uniforms and wore a plaque with the word "Rongsheng" on their waists. They were particularly eye-catching standing in front of the palace gate.

"So those are the people from Rongsheng Academy? The nameplates hanging around their waists are actually made of fine white jade?"

"That's nothing. I heard that all students who enter Rongsheng Academy will have an identity badge, but it's divided into gold, silver, bronze and iron according to the four classes of A, B, C, and D. This jade badge is only given to students in the Tianzi class, and each one is made of the finest white jade."

"I heard that the word Rongsheng comes from your Majesty's name?"

"Yes, it is taken from your Majesty's courtesy name and the surname of the late Rong Taifu. Taifu Rong was once the most outstanding student in the capital. The Empress is so talented because of his teachings."

"Rongsheng Academy is really impressive this time. I think they alone account for half of the people. The others don't look as energetic as them..."

There were many common people outside the palace gate. Although they did not dare to get close because of the sword-wielding guards, they watched the students in front of the palace gate from afar and whispered to each other.

The eyes of the people around were shining, and voices could be heard faintly, mostly discussing Rongsheng Academy. The other students in front of the palace gate could not help but look over, and saw that the group of people from Rongsheng Academy were as tall as pine and cypress, with their backs straight and their faces full of confidence and pride.

"What are they so proud of? They're just relying on the fact that Rongsheng Academy was founded by the Empress. The Empress supports the children from poor families, so naturally she's partial to them."

"That's right. Now that the Queen is in power and His Majesty hasn't returned, those people in the court are blindly trying to curry favor with the Queen. Maybe even the final review favored the people from Rongsheng Academy. Who knows how they got on the list..."

On the side of the powerful, two people who were dressed in gorgeous clothes and whose limelight was overshadowed could not help but curse in a low voice.

Feng Yian turned his head and said, "Shut up. Are you accusing someone in the court of favoritism and corruption?"

He looked at the two people talking beside him with a cold gaze, his eyes full of fierceness.

"This time, the exam papers were sealed and marked with names. From the moment you finished answering the questions and sent your papers to the examination room, all the examiners reviewed them together. During this period, all officials ate and lived together, and even their restrooms were supervised. Thousands of exam papers were stacked together, and no one knew who wrote which one."

"Until the examiners determine the rankings and send them to the palace for the Empress to examine, no one knows who will make the list. How can those court officials favor Rongsheng Academy and use this to curry favor with the Empress? Do you know that if this gets out, slandering the court officials and the Empress is a capital crime!"

The two men's faces turned pale instantly after hearing Feng Yian's words.

Everyone knows how much the Empress takes this imperial examination seriously. Starting from the preliminary round, anyone caught cheating will be sent straight to jail, no matter what their family background is. Those officials who were in favoritism in setting up the examination halls were also dismissed and beheaded.

This exam in the capital was even stricter than the previous ones. The two prime ministers on the left and right, along with more than ten ministers in the court, were in charge of supervising the exam. The imperial guards, the Beijing patrol camp, and the Jingzhao Prefecture were on duty for supervision and guarding. The only person caught cheating had been executed on the spot. Who would dare to cheat for personal gain and risk losing their head and implicating their entire clan?

They were just venting their anger for the moment. The person who had spoken earlier quickly said, "That's not what I meant. I just can't stand the people at Rongsheng Academy. If it weren't for the Empress's support for the establishment of the academy, how could they compare to us..."

Feng Yian frowned and looked at him: "Narrow-minded!"

"The Empress did indeed plan to build the academy, but that only gave those people a chance to make a name for themselves. It's been less than a year since they started school. Even if the academy has taught them a little, they have the potential to flourish naturally."

"You and I come from far superior backgrounds. We were able to receive instruction they couldn't, and read books they couldn't. If you really think about it, we've always had the advantage. If they had enjoyed the same resources as us from a young age, we might not be standing here today."

Feng Yian glanced at the two officials' sons who had turned pale at what he said, as well as the others who were still dissatisfied:

"The court is no longer what it used to be. Your Majesty and the Empress will not wrong capable people. If you want to stand out, work hard on your own. Don't waste your time on useless jealousy and say things that will bring disaster to yourself and your family!"

Feng Yian gave a warning and walked towards the students from Rongsheng Academy.

"My name is Feng Yian, nice to meet you all."

Feng Yian looked at Li Chi and the others with a gentle expression: "This must be Brother Li and Brother Huang, nice to meet you."

Li Chi and Huang Hong seldom went out to socialize after entering the academy. Later, when they heard that the imperial examination was about to be held, they buried themselves in books every day. In addition, the aristocratic families and the empress were in a big fight during that period. They, the students in the academy who were nominally under the "emperor and empress", never interacted with the children of the aristocratic families, but this did not prevent them from knowing some things in the capital.

For example, Feng Yian in front of us.

I heard that this Feng Silangjun is a descendant of the Feng family's side branch. In the past, that branch was not valued by the main branch. Later, after the head of the Feng family was replaced by the current Lord Feng Qiuli, Feng Yian's lineage gradually gained attention. Feng Yian was even taken care of by Feng Qiuli personally. In this exam, Feng Yian got second place.

Li Chi and the others originally thought that a young man from a noble family like Feng Yian would definitely be arrogant and conceited, but they didn't expect him to be so friendly.

The two of them bowed quickly and said, "Greetings, Brother Feng."

Feng Yian smiled and said, "I heard my uncle mention you guys a while ago, but I never had the chance to meet you before. Now I finally get to see you."

"And this Brother Jin." He smiled and pulled in Jin Shengyu, who was standing beside him. "The students in Jiangnan are so talented. Brother Jin's poems were spread throughout the Wei Dynasty a few years ago. I have admired you for a long time, and now I finally meet you."

Jin Shengyu was handsome, and his clothes were not luxurious but elegant. Seeing Feng Yian take the initiative to greet him, he quickly said humbly, "Brother Feng, you are too kind."

Feng Yian had lived in an aristocratic family since he was a child. Even though he was from a branch of the family, he was much more sophisticated than his peers. In addition, he had inherited Feng Qiuli's "true teachings". It only took a few words for him to become close to Li Chi and the others.

The three of them chatted and laughed for a while before Feng Yian looked at the person standing behind Li Chi.

"Who is this?"

Huang Hong looked honest and said quickly, "This is Zhu Xiyan, Senior Brother Zhu. He was injured a while ago and hasn't recovered yet, so he can't speak. Brother Feng, please forgive me."
